Venbrook Names Jeff Lang Executive Vice President, Retail Services Practice Leader
Venbrook Group, LLC (“Venbrook”), one of the largest independent insurance solutions and risk management firms in the U.S., today announced the appointment of Jeff Lang as Executive Vice President, Retail Services.
With three decades of experience and an extensive background in the retail insurance brokerage business, Lang will oversee all aspects of Venbrook’s retail segment, including expansion of its property and casualty, employee benefits, student insurance, and government defense divisions, and a special emphasis on growing high net worth personal lines. Lang joins Venbrook from USI Insurance Services and has held positions at Aon, Marsh, Chubb, and others.
